As The Marvels' theatrical debut draws near, Marvel Studios has released two new clips from the Nia DaCosta-helmed MCU sequel.

The first is included as part of a TV spot, and features a call-back to Monica Rambeau's debut in WandaVision, with Carol Danvers and Kamala Khan attempting to come up with a codename for their teammate based on her abilities. Danvers mentions "Vision," before remembering that the name is taken!

We had been led to believe that Rambeau would go by Photon in the movie, but that's since been disputed. Based on her description of her powers in this clip, Spectrum seems like a more likely possibility.

The second clip finds Ms. Marvel fan-girling out upon realizing that her idol, Captain Marvel, was in her house.

"In Marvel Studios’ The Marvels, Carol Danvers aka Captain Marvel has reclaimed her identity from the tyrannical Kree and taken revenge on the Supreme Intelligence. But unintended consequences see Carol shouldering the burden of a destabilized universe. When her duties send her to an anomalous wormhole linked to a Kree revolutionary, her powers become entangled with that of Jersey City super-fan Kamala Khan, aka Ms. Marvel, and Carol’s estranged niece, now S.A.B.E.R. astronaut Captain Monica Rambeau. Together, this unlikely trio must team up and learn to work in concert to save the universe as The Marvels.”

The film also stars Zawe Ashton and Park Seo-joon. Nia DaCosta directs, and Kevin Feige is the producer. Louis D’Esposito, Victoria Alonso, Mary Livanos and Matthew Jenkins serve as executive producers. The screenplay is by Megan McDonnell, Nia DaCosta, Elissa Karasik and Zeb Wells.

The Marvels will begin its international rollout on November 8, and was recently granted a China release on November 10, day-and-date with North America.
